Why sponsor?

Sponsoring a dog is quite possibly one of the kindest things you can do for our dogs, who prior to being taken on at our shelter, have never had anyone looking out for them before - but now they have you, their sponsor.

When you sponsor a Lucky’s dog, you are helping to pay for the food, vet bills and daily care of one of our Romanian rescues, until they are lucky enough to find their perfect forever home.

What do Sponsor’s receive?

As a sponsor, you will receive monthly updates on your chosen dog! The updates will include pictures and information on how they’ve been getting on at the shelter. You will also be the first to hear about their progress and when they are matched to a family or moving on to a foster home.

You will also be sent a certificate of sponsorship that you are able to download and print yourself!

Our Mission

At Lucky's, we have always strived to be a responsible rescue who not only rescues, rehabilitates and rehomes dogs from Romania, but also works towards actively reducing the stray dog issue through spay and neuter campaigns across the country.

From the moment Lucky's began, we wanted to ensure that the dogs we took into our care were given the best medical treatment, good-quality food, enriching spaces to learn and had access to a variety of people through our overseas volunteer programme so that our dogs are as socialised as possible, prior to being assessed and rehomed.

 

Our goal is to get the rehoming of our dogs right first time. We want to ensure that when our dogs eventually travel home, whether that be directly from Romania or from one of our UK-based fosterers, it is for the rest of their life. This is achieved in two ways; thorough assessments of dogs prior to being matched to an adopter; and through an in-depth, three-stage home-checking process.

 

We want to be a shining example of overseas rescue done in the right way.
